These figures cover 364 flights between July 2025 and June 2026. On-time means an arrival less than 15 minutes after the scheduled gate time, the same threshold the Department of Transportation uses in its own reports. Cancelled and diverted flights are excluded from the on-time rate and counted separately, which is why the cancellation column matters on its own.

A 07:00 departure sits in the 5am–8am window. Across every US flight scheduled in that window the on-time rate is 89.3%, and DL 1009 runs 11 points worse at 78.7%. Early departures usually start with an aircraft that has not flown yet that day, which is most of why the window does well.

35% of delay minutes are charged to the National Airspace System: air traffic volume, runway configuration, ground stops. No carrier can price its way out of that, which is why airport choice moves the number here more than carrier choice does. That is 1,800 minutes out of 5,101, against a national NAS share of 21%. 7.0% of arrivals land an hour or more late, close to the national 8.1%. That is the figure that decides a connection, and it says a 60 to 75 minute layover is reasonable here while anything under 45 minutes is a bet. Most delays on this route last about an hour, which a normal layover absorbs.

At 1,969 miles this is transcontinental flying, and long routes get a quiet structural advantage. Scheduled block time on a flight this length carries more padding in absolute minutes, so a twenty-minute late departure often still becomes an on-time arrival. Read the on-time rate here as slightly flattering next to a short-haul route with the same operational quality.
